Transaction 017135c6121a251617cc7fdad2990b44184d5821788d69366216e7d6a407b476
1 Input
1 Output
-
017135c6121a251617cc7fdad2990b44184d5821788d69366216e7d6a407b476:0
- value
- 334961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1044f0f8292d2c2f1e62c92d866763abed1b9482 OP_EQUAL
- address
- 33B3Kjjagd5k4Bv185Esg8iexGYMJVhE3H